DUNAN DROIGHIONN MOR | "Dùnan Droighionn Mòr" "Dùnan Droighionn Mòr" "Dùnan Droighionn Mòr" |
A. McCulloch Ardchorie J. McInnes, Gylen Park Mr Livingstone. Uilt |
098 | A small round hillock a short distance northwest of Gylen Castle. Sig: [Signification] Big Hillock of the Thorns. |
PORT NA LIGHE | Port an Rolaidh Port an Rolaidh Port na Lighe Port na Lighe Port na Lighe |
A. McCulloch_ J. McInnes. Mr Livingstone Lachlan McLachlan. Ferry Ho. [House] Allan McDougall. Slatrach_ |
098 | A small creek or inlet southwest of the above knoll, so called from the manner in which a lot of round stones, which are in the creek, are rolled backwards and forwards with each succeeding wave. Sign. [Signification] The Rolling Port. but "Port na Lighe" Port of the Flood. is better known. |
GYLEN | Gylen Gylen Gylen |
A. McCulloch. J. McInes. Mr Livingstone |
098 | A small thatched farmsteading about a mile northwest of Ardchorie. The property of McDougall of Dunolly |
